3. MICROALGAE IN FOOD SUPPLEMENTS
Microalgae are increasingly used in the production of
food supplements They offer a sustainable
alternative to traditional sources of nutrients such as
fish oil and animal-derived ingredients.
Microalgae-based supplements provide a rich source
of vitamins and minerals, including vitamin B12,
iron, and calcium Incorporating microalgae into food
supplements can help meet the growing demand for
plant-based and eco-friendly options.
4. FOOD SUPPLEMENT CONTINUE
Microalgae are increasingly being used in the production
of food supplements to boost nutritional value.
They can be incorporated into protein powders energy
bars and functional beverages Microalgae derived proteins
are highly digestible and contain all essential amino acids
making them an excellent plant- based protein source.
Moreover, microalgae provide natural pigments like
chlorophyll and carotenoids, which enhance the visual
appeal of food products.
5. MICROALGAE IN NUTRACEUTICALS
Microalgae have gained significant attention in the
nutraceuticals industry.
They can be used to produce functional foods, dietary
supplements, and cosmeceuticals.
The high omega-3 fatty acid content in microalgae makes
them a valuable source for heart health and brain function
Furthermore, their antimicrobial and anti-inflammatory
properties make them suitable for various health
applications.
6. NATURE'S NUTRITIONAL SOURCE
Microalgae are highly nutritious and offer a wide range of
health benefits.
They are a rich source of vitamins, minerals, and
phytonutrients. Additionally, microalgan contain essential
amino acids and polyunsaturated fatty acids, including
DHA and EPA, which are crucial for brain health and
cardiovascular function.
Their unique nutritional profile makes them ideal for
developing nutraceutical products and food supplements.
